West Brow, Georgia

West Brow is an unincorporated community and census-designated place (CDP) on the eastern side of Dade County, Georgia, United States.

It is on top of Lookout Mountain, along Georgia State Route 189, which leads northeast 5 miles (8 km) to the city of Lookout Mountain.

Trenton, the Dade county seat, is 8 miles (13 km) to the southwest in the Lookout Valley.
